Rose Garden, Coburg

The Rose Garden (German: Rosengarten) is a park in Coburg, Bavaria, Germany, located between the Ketschentor (town gate) and the Angerturnhalle (a gym).

[1]: 60  The Rose Garden was significantly adapted in the 1960s, when the Congress Centre was built at the north of the park.

Despite its location being near streets, noise levels are low, and the appearance of the park has improved as the plants have grown.
